Sales Manager – South Richmond, VALead the Next Chapter of Growth
Redline Powersports Group is one of the fastest-growing powersports dealership groups in the Southeast, expanding to five locations in less than five years through disciplined execution and an uncompromising focus on the customer experience.
We're looking for an exceptional Sales Manager to lead our South Richmond, Virginia dealership. This is an opportunity for a proven leader who thrives on accountability, builds high-performing teams, and is passionate about driving results.
We don't just sell motorcycles, ATVs, side-by-sides, personal watercraft, and Slingshots—we deliver a lifestyle built around adventure, freedom, and unforgettable experiences.
What You'll DoAs Sales Manager, you will be responsible for leading every aspect of the sales department, including:
Coaching, developing, and holding the sales team accountable to performance expectations.
Driving showroom traffic into sold units through proven sales processes.
Working deals, desking transactions, and maximizing profitability while maintaining an outstanding customer experience.
Partnering with Finance & Insurance to ensure smooth deal flow and strong product penetration.
Monitoring inventory, aging, pricing, and merchandising to maximize inventory turns.
Utilizing CRM tools to ensure consistent follow-up and lead management.
Recruiting, hiring, and developing top sales talent.
Leading from the showroom floor—not from behind a desk.

Minimum of 3 years of dealership management experience in powersports, automotive, RV, marine, or a similar retail industry.
Proven history of leading a high-performing sales team with measurable results.
Strong understanding of dealership operations, including:
Sales process
Deal structuring and desking
F&I workflow
CRM management
Inventory management
A hands‑on leadership style with exceptional communication and coaching abilities.
High level of integrity, professionalism, and accountability.
Stable employment history with excellent, verifiable references.
Ability to successfully pass background and pre‑employment screening.
